Uhle's Blend 300
(3.33)
A graham cracker drizzled with honey, this is the perfect blend for a Burley lover looking for a smidge of sweetness. Ingredients: Cube-cut and ribbon Burley with black Cavendish.
Notes: The description from an older Uhle's brochure reads, "Cube-cut with Honey-Hive flavoring ... just a youngster as our blends go ... since 1948 ... but what a blend! You can smoke it day in and day out and never tire of the flavor. What can you say about a blend like this in a short space ... it's really elegant smoking. Too good to blend with anything else."

Very similar to Perfection Plug Burley in presentation: a classic cube cut of medium brown burley. The charring light is very sweet, but absent any bite or heat. The true light brings exactly what's promised: a smooth smoking burley/Cavendish blend with natural honey, molasses and light vanilla notes. I suppose this blend is what happens when you mix Perfection Plug with a bit of Cavendish and a touch more flavoring - and its glorious. In fact, it's everything most modern burley/Cavendish blends are not: dry-smoking, natural-tasting, and clean-burning. Both the smoker and those in the room will be pleased.
For its type, four enthusiastic stars. One of the best aromatics I have tasted. The U.S. has a treasure trove of outstanding aromatics with boutique houses such as Uhle's, Pipeworks & Wilke, and Peretti, just to name a few. Do your taste buds a favor, get a bit off the beaten path, and try them. You won't regret it.

This is a fabulous cubed Burley blend in the fine tradition of classic American blends. This is the epitome of old-fashioned pipe tobacco. If you at all enjoy Pease's Barbary Coast, then you must try this fine tobacco. In my opinion, it is a superior example of what good Burley should be.
The quality of the leaf is excellent. Nice smallish cubes with some light and dark flake that packs well and burns effortlessly. All the nutty/creamy Burley flavor you could want with none of the bitterness. The casing is very slight - just enough to gently sweeten the Burley and enhance the fragrance. I can almost taste cinnamon and brown sugar in the background. The room aroma will never offend anyone.
This tobacco is one of the best I have smoked over the years and certainly at the top-of-the-class for Burleys. I would really like to see more folks try Uhle's tobaccos. They are a small shop that turns out really great product in the fine American tradition (although they have some Latakia blends that are really excellent as well).

I have to give credit where credit is due. Uhle's Blend #300 has become my new "go to" smoke.
Now I know some of you might see "Honey-Hive flavoring" and commence to shudder but I really must say it is quite delightful. Not sickeningly sweet and cloying like you might suspect, I would describe it as almost crisp and clean. On first light an almost ethereal whisper of honey emanates from the bowl. This soon settles into a solid, slighty sweet and nutty burley flavor. It burns evenly right to the bottom of the bowl. I would suggest to any burley lovers or someone looking for a light aromatic to give this blend a try. I am also quite proud of it being a "local" blend (Uhle's is based in Milwaukee, I'm in Appleton, WI.) Thanks for reading!
